    Default EVE Online mission multiboxing ships ?

    Do we still have anyone multiboxing EVE? I know Bradster was kicking ass there for a while. I'm going to pick back up EVE Online when the new xpack hits (March 10th). My goal is to have accounts that pay for themselves within 6 months, to become filthy rich -- 100B is my long term goal -- and then PVP for the lulz.

    Last time I quit I got rid of all my high SP characters so I'll be starting over from scratch skill-wise, I do have my forum posting account alt who has around 500M ISK as a nest egg for when I wanted to come back. So I do have a rather good leg up on getting restarted since I can easily buy ships, skills and implants right off the bat.

    I've done the whole industry & market thing before; T1/ship production is okay but the market-pvp is more cutthroat than any pirate, lol. Mining in 0.0 with multiple accounts is boring but easy ISK and would be a pretty fast skillup. But I don't have access to 0.0 and don't really have any contacts to get access anymore. And I think I'd rather like to stay in empire with some fat implants for at least a few months.
    Exploration is interesting to me, especially with the wormhole stuff coming out. But it needs some high SP totals to scan down and then handle the sites, especially looking at how tough the Sleepers are from the test server videos.

    My current plan is to set up 3-5 accounts and start by spamming the heck out of missions. I get standings this way for jump clones which I want anyhow, it's about as low-risk as you can get, I can login and play whenever without worrying about locals or wars. I can spend a few months this way training in empire with nice implants and , then move on to bigger and better things in 0.0 with some skills under my belt. I think I can get up to handle L3's within 2 weeks easily, which make pretty decent standings gain and ISK. Probably not enough to play for multiple accounts, but enough to buy skills and ships easily and build up a decent wallet balance.After that look into access for 0.0 space and either rat or mine on multiple accounts while training up a PVP alt.


    I'm torn between what race/ship setup would be the best for boxing missions though. Thoughts:

    Caldari - Caracal or Drake w/ FoF heavy missiles - I heard FoFs still kind of suck, shoot structures, won't target out past 80? km, sometimes won't shoot at hostiles, etc. But if you ran 5 Drakes with them, thats 35 launchers. Solving problems through overwhelming firepower? And the idea of a capless passive tank is very appealing since it's just one less bit of micromanagement to deal with. Warp in, F1->F7, and fly to the next gate while you watch the carnage. If it works...

    Gallente - Vexor or Myrmidon (or a Dominix) w/ drones. I know with reasonable skills you can AFK many missions this way, warp in and grab aggro, launch drones, go afk... sounds like it would scale easily to multiple ships. Sentry drones are pretty kickass DPS and instant recall if they get aggro. It wouldn't be hard to do some remote rep spider tank either, which would get me into harder missions that much faster with lower skills. I'm strongly leaning towards this setup since drones are not as stupid as FoF missiles and you can set them to assist (or defend) someone, so I can link up and focus fire with one character. Drone skills would also help with mining if I got access to nice 0.0 mining. And beyond the ship skills, most drone and fitting skills I'd want right away would be int/mem same as learning, so I can focus stats and then do the attribute respec later on once I need guns and more ship skills... int mem learning to 3/4 and some +3 implants will be super fast training right out of the gate.

    Amarr - ? some laser boat. Lasers melt face and are probably what I'd want for PVP anyhow... but it sounds like a lot of micro, with targeting and such since there's no way to assist and autotargeters have been broken / useless since the game came out. Bit more skill intensive too. But it would certainly be fun shooting things with 40 lasers, pewpewpew!

    Minmatar I don't really like... split weapon ships, generally more skill-intensive. Open to suggestions though.

    Well bombs are 0.0 only and I don't think the Manticore is great for missions. In PVP I'd be single-account or maybe some scouts/cyno alts of course if I got into cap ships. I like small gang more than big fleet engagements though.

    Looking at 5 accounts because of fleet size for gang boosters, if I did get back to 0.0 mining an Orca + 4 miners is something around 250-300M+ an hour last time I played which is pretty sweet income. I can run 5-6 accounts comfortably on my hardware, 4 on main machine and 1-2 on laptop. So I'd just be out the initial cost, ~150 bucks for 60 days of game time or more with buddy system. Hopefully in 2 months I can afford game time with ISK so there'd be no more $ cost after that.

    And yeah it really only takes 1 account to run any L4 or maybe 2-3 to run any L5. You gain speed from multiple accounts in the same mission but beyond 2-3 ships I think its diminishing returns as you spend a larger % of your time traveling, which isn't helped by having multiple ships. The idea though is to get into the tougher missions sooner, and to then get skills for a mostly AFK setup so I can do missions in parallel.
    For example I could be in 5 Myrmidons running L3s in a matter of 2-3 days. Then skill up more and maybe do 2 missions with 2 ships each, and the 5th guy salvaging/looting. Then move to a Dominix and run 2-3 L4s in parallel. And with a good location with multiple agents nearby you can pick and choose your missions, avoid the ones that give the faction hits and farming multiple Extravaganzas or Worlds Collide or whatever gets the most ISK.

    Currnetly in eve. you enter a belt / mission whatever. your "tank" hits the rats. They all attack the tank. Your other people are basically free to do whatever at that point without fear of them fighting back.

    If they revamp the AI that might not be the case. If you come in with a ship set to tank the rats could just ignore you since theres no real taunt mechanic in the game. Just wanted to throw it out there so he would be aware.
